{"data":{"id":"us-ky/krs-179.240","jurisdiction":"us-ky","citation":"KRS 179.240","heading":"Owner to remove obstructions -- Dead trees not to be left standing near","body":"roads.\n(1) The owner or occupant of land situated along a public road shall remove from the\nright-of-way, all obstructions, including fences and buildings, which have been\nplaced there either by himself or by his consent.\n(2) No person shall kill a tree and leave it standing within fifty (50) feet of any public\nroad.","path":["KRS Chapter 179"],"source_url":"https://apps.legislature.ky.gov/law/statutes/statute.aspx?id=5495","current_through":"Includes enactments through the 2026 Regular Session","vintage":"09/05/2026","retrieved_at":"2026-09-05T20:51:31Z","sha256":"7db5eb15f7e955ec1f08026fabb21ea8546e9f2d038daf00b6697dd47a99bbe7","source_id":"us-ky","stale":false,"prev":"us-ky/krs-179.230","next":"us-ky/krs-179.250"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
